AgentOps + Microsoft Copilot Studio: Complete MCP Integration
AgentOps is a MCP server that Provide observability and tracing for debugging AI agents with AgentOps API..
When integrated with Microsoft Copilot Studio, you can:
- Authorize with AgentOps API key
- Retrieve trace information by ID
- Get span information by ID

Step 2: Configure Microsoft Copilot Studio
- Enable Generative Orchestration
Generative Orchestration must be enabled in your Copilot Studio environment to use MCP
Visit: https://learn.microsoft.com/en-us/microsoft-copilot-studio/agent-extend-action-mcp
Note: This is a prerequisite - MCP will not work without it
- Access Copilot Studio
Log in to Microsoft Copilot Studio with appropriate permissions to create and configure agents
Visit: https://copilotstudio.microsoft.com
Note: Requires organizational access or trial subscription
- Navigate to Connectors
In Copilot Studio, go to the Connectors section where you can add new integrations
Note: Location may vary based on interface updates
- Create MCP Connector
Click "Add Connector" and select "Model Context Protocol (MCP)" from the available connector types
Note: Use the YAML schema template provided by Copilot Studio
- Configure {server_name} Connection
Fill in the YAML schema with {server_name} server details including command, arguments, and environment variables
agentops
Note: Copilot Studio dynamically reflects changes as tools and resources are updated on the MCP server
- Add Tools to Agent
Once connected, add the MCP server tools and resources to your specific agent through the Copilot Studio UI
Note: Currently supports Tools and Resources (Prompts not yet supported)
- Test Agent Capabilities
Test your agent to verify it can access and use the {server_name} tools correctly

Troubleshooting
Common Issues
Generative Orchestration Not Available
Symptoms: MCP option not visible, Cannot add MCP connectors
Cause: Generative Orchestration is not enabled for your environment
Solution:
- Contact your Microsoft 365 administrator
- Enable Generative Orchestration in tenant settings
- Verify your subscription includes Copilot Studio with MCP support
- Check Microsoft Learn documentation for enablement steps
MCP Connector Connection Failed
Symptoms: Connector shows "Disconnected" status, Tools not available to agent
Cause: MCP server not accessible or configuration error
Solution:
- Verify the MCP server command is correct and accessible
- Check all required environment variables are set
- Test the MCP server independently outside Copilot Studio
- Review YAML schema for syntax errors
- Check network connectivity and firewall rules
Tools Not Appearing in Agent
Symptoms: Connector connected but tools missing, Agent cannot invoke MCP tools
Cause: Tools not added to agent or synchronization issue
Solution:
- Manually add tools to agent through Copilot Studio UI
- Refresh connector to sync latest tools from MCP server
- Verify tools are published on the MCP server
- Check agent configuration includes the MCP connector
MCP Server Tools Update Not Reflected
Symptoms: New tools not appearing, Old tools still visible after removal
Cause: Copilot Studio cache or sync delay
Solution:
- Disconnect and reconnect the MCP connector
- Wait a few minutes for dynamic sync to occur
- Manually refresh the connector in Copilot Studio
- Restart the MCP server if possible
